Number: 90031979
Country: Germany
Source: TED
Number: 90032052
Number: 90032361
Number: 90032563
Number: 90033402
Number: 1199267
Country: Romania
Number: 1199268
Country: Spain
Number: 1199269
Country: Norway
Number: 1199270
Country: France
Number: 1199271
Country: Netherlands
Number: 1199272
Country: Poland